Conditions at Banzai in November
November: Storm Track Fires Up
November is where the season really locks in. Average wave height climbs to 3ft (0.9m), period to 5.2s, and ideal wind to 19%. The swell rose is full in the favorable directions: SSE 14.5%, SW 12.8%, S 11.7%, WSW 11.2%, SSW 8.1%, with the occasional 6.5-8ft (2-2.5m) set from strong SW winds. The wind field makes a decisive turn back toward the northeast: NE (12.8%), NNE (11.8%), and ENE (6.9%) create frequent offshore conditions, giving Banzai clean, rideable faces. Cyclogenesis in the Gulf of Genoa becomes a regular feature, and each passing front can produce a day of punchy, short-period surf. Water temp cools to 17.5°C, air to 14.5°C, and precipitation rises to 3.80mm/day - the wettest month. A 4/3 wetsuit and a flexible schedule are the keys to unlocking November.
